TMaRS provides reporting tools to track training completion, view individual training histories, and generate compliance reports. Use these reports for audits, certifications, and tracking training program effectiveness.

Reports Overview

Required Attributes

To access reports, you need:

  • Reports View - Access to reporting features
  • Reports Admin - Full reporting access including sensitive data

Different reports may have additional attribute requirements.

TMaRS includes two primary reports for tracking training:

  • Persons Training History - View all training for a specific person
  • Completion Report - Generate lists of people who completed specific courses

Accessing Reports

To access reports:

  1. Navigate to Reports in the sidebar
  2. Click on the report you want to run:
    • Persons Training History
    • Completion Report

Persons Training History

Persons Training History

The Persons Training History report shows all training records for a specific individual. This is useful for:

  • Looking up someone's training transcript
  • Verifying certification status
  • Checking if someone has completed required training
  • Reviewing someone's training history for audits

Running the Report

Search for Training History

To generate a training history report:

  1. Navigate to Reports → Persons Training History
  2. Enter the person's NetId
  3. Choose Start Date and End Date for the report range
  4. Optionally use the name search if you don't know their NetID
  5. Click Search for Training History
Reports Training Search

Report Parameters

Field Description Required
NetId The person's university NetID. This is the primary search field. Yes (or use name search)
Choose a Start Date Beginning of date range. Default is 01/01/1994 (beginning of records). Yes
Choose an End Date End of date range. Default is today's date. Yes
Optional Helper: Name Search Search by last name, first name if you don't know the NetID. No

Tip: The default date range covers all training records in the system. If you only need recent training, narrow the date range to improve performance and readability.

Understanding the Results

Training History Results

Training History Results

The results page shows the person's full name and employee information at the top, followed by their training history organized by their different job positions (each with a unique MSU ID).

Each section lists classes they've taken, showing course ID, class title, provider, enrollment status, and certification status.

Reports Training History

The report displays training grouped by the person's job records. Each group shows:

  • Header line - MSU ID, NetID, Name, Job Title, Department, Status, Degree info
  • Training table with columns:
    • Course Id - Unique course identifier
    • Class Title - Name of the class
    • Class Provider - Which organizational unit offered it
    • Enrollment Status - Enrolled, Completed, Cancelled, etc.
    • Certification Status - Trained, Not Certified, or Expired with expiration date

Certification Status Indicators

The Certification Status column uses color-coded indicators:

  • Trained (green) - Certification is current and valid
  • Not Certified (red) - Did not complete or was cancelled
  • Expired (red) - Certification has expired with expiration date shown

About Multiple Job Records

If a person has held multiple positions at MSU, they'll have separate sections for each job record. This is normal and allows tracking training across their entire career at the university.

Completion Report

Completion Report

The Completion Report generates lists of people who have taken specific courses within a date range. This report is ideal for:

  • Compliance reporting (who completed required training)
  • Tracking course attendance over time
  • Identifying people who need refresher training
  • Exporting training data for external systems
  • Generating lists for follow-up communications

Running the Report

To generate a completion report:

  1. Navigate to Reports → Completion Report
  2. Select which Status Types to include
  3. Choose Start Date and End Date
  4. Select Report Type (Screen or Excel)
  5. Optionally filter by specific people's NetIDs
  6. Select one or more courses from the table
  7. Click Query System
Completion Report Search

Report Parameters

Parameter Description
Status Types to include Check which enrollment statuses to include in results:
  • Waitlisted
  • Enrolled
  • Completed
  • Could Not Complete
  • Removed - Lacks Prerequisites

Typically, check all or just "Completed" for compliance reports.

Choose a Start Date Beginning of date range. Default is 01/01/1994.
Choose an End Date End of date range. Default is today.
Report Type Screen Report - View results on screen with interactive table
Excel Report - Download results as Excel file (.xlsx)
NetId's Of Specific People Optional: Enter specific NetIDs (one per line or comma-separated) to limit results to only those people. Leave blank to include everyone.
Course Selection Check one or more courses from the table. Use the search box to find specific courses. You can select multiple courses to combine results.

Tip: Use the course table search box to quickly find courses by name or abbreviation. You can select multiple courses to see who completed any of them during the date range.

Screen Report Results

If you selected Screen Report, the results display on screen in an interactive table.

The screen report includes:

  • Search Requested - Summary of your parameters
  • Result count - How many records matched
  • Interactive table with columns:
    • Record Id - Unique enrollment record
    • Course Id - Course identifier
    • Course Title - Name of course
    • Class Location - Where it was held
    • Enrollment Status - Completed, Enrolled, etc.
    • Training Validity - TRAINED indicator
    • NetId / MSU Id# - Person identifiers
    • Name - Full name (hover for biographical details)
    • Title - Job title
    • MSU Status - Staff, Faculty, etc.
    • Details - Button for full biographical information
  • DataTables controls - Entries per page, search, sort, pagination

Excel Report Download

If you selected Excel Report, the system generates a downloadable Excel file (.xlsx) with all results.

Excel Report Structure

Excel Report Structure

The Excel file contains one sheet named "Training Status" with comprehensive data including:

  • Report metadata (creation date, query parameters)
  • Enrollment details (ID, timestamps, course info, location, status)
  • Person details (NetID, MSU ID, name, email)
  • Employment info (title, department, division, codes)
  • Student info (if applicable - type, degree, major)
Completion Report Excel

The Excel report includes over 30 columns of data, making it ideal for:

  • Importing into other systems
  • Advanced filtering and analysis in Excel
  • Creating pivot tables
  • Compliance documentation
  • Long-term record keeping

Best Practices

For quick checks: Use Screen Report to view results immediately
For compliance/audits: Use Excel Report to download complete data
For regular reporting: Save your Excel reports with descriptive filenames including date and course name

Common Use Cases

Annual compliance report:

  1. Select status: Completed only
  2. Date range: January 1 to December 31 of the year
  3. Select all required training courses
  4. Report type: Excel Report
  5. Generate and save

Find who needs refresher training:

  1. Select status: Completed only
  2. Date range: Older than certification period (e.g., 2 years ago)
  3. Select the course
  4. Report type: Screen Report
  5. These people need to retake the course

Check specific department compliance:

  1. Get NetIDs for department members
  2. Paste NetIDs in "NetId's Of Specific People" field
  3. Select required courses
  4. Report type: Excel Report
  5. Filter in Excel to find who's missing training
